Bently Nevada 3300 NSv Proximity Probe (330905-05-08-10-12-00)

Superior chemical resistance for demanding applications. This Bently Nevada 3300 NSv probe features FluidLoc cable and enhanced side-view performance. New in factory packaging with 12-month warranty.

Key Advantages

  • Chemical-resistant design for harsh environments
  • FluidLoc cable prevents oil migration
  • Improved side-view characteristics vs 3000-series probes
  • Wide temperature range: -52°C to +177°C
  • ClickLoc connector for secure connections

Complete Model Breakdown

  • 330905 → 3300 NSv Probe base model
  • 05 → 50mm unthreaded length
  • 08 → 80mm case length
  • 10 → 1.0 meter cable
  • 12 → ClickLoc with FluidLoc cable
  • 00 → Standard approvals

Technical Specifications

  • Thread Size: M10×1
  • Probe Resistance: 4.2Ω ±0.5
  • Linear Range: 0.25-1.75mm (10-70 mils)
  • Frequency Response: 0-10kHz (±3dB)
  • Minimum Target: 8.9mm diameter
  • Bend Radius: 25.4mm minimum
  • Torque Rating: 7.5N•m recommended
